federal poverty level

federal poverty level
сокр. FPL гос. фин., амер. федеральный уровень бедности (минимальный уровень дохода, необходимый для удовлетворения основных нужды в пище и одежде, а также оплаты жилья, транспорта и приобретения других товаров и услуг первой необходимости; величина федерального уровня бедности ежегодно перерасcчитывается и публикуется Министерством здравоохранения и социальных услуг; устанавливается в разных размерах в зависимости от величины семьи; возможность участия во многих программах государственной помощи и величина получаемого государственного пособия зависят от соотношения федерального уровня бедности и фактической величины дохода определенного лица/семьи)
